Re: Username and password for PDC on Zentyal 3
« Reply #8 on: October 07, 2012, 02:39:19 pm »
Hello,
 do you know that the entry for the first DNS on your client must be the ip of the PDC ? If your PDC isn't your gateway, you can add a foward in the DNS section to your Gateway IP
 Try to ping the fully qualified hostname for example "ping zentyal.zentyal-domine.lan",   first localy from your PDC and then from the Client-mashine.

... and do you know how you join a client mashine to a Domain?

... to join the mashine to the Domain you have start xp or win7 with admin rights and than change the workgroup to your Domain by
right-click COMPTER / go to Comtunername and change. Therefor, its the best to take the Administator user, where you first changed the password to one you know.
Then reboot your windows client and can connect a user to the Domain.

Re: Username and password for PDC on Zentyal 3
« Reply #9 on: October 07, 2012, 03:36:51 pm »
In a M$ AD the PDC is usually the DHCP server and its important to have both DNS and NTP set to the AD.

The NTP is important as well as any clock skew will result in kerberos authentication errors.

Also the administrator account is setup with a random password. From memory its in var/lib/zentyal/conf.

Easier just to change the password to something more memorable.
